Ala’a El Ameen is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ala’a El Ameen has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 572 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Ophthalmology, 11 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and 4 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Ala’a El Ameen’s work include Retinal Diseases and Treatments (10 papers), Retinal Imaging and Analysis (9 papers) and Retinal and Optic Conditions (8 papers). Ala’a El Ameen is often cited by papers focused on Retinal Diseases and Treatments (10 papers), Retinal Imaging and Analysis (9 papers) and Retinal and Optic Conditions (8 papers). Ala’a El Ameen coll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and Italy. Ala’a El Ameen's co-authors include Alexandra Mière, Oudy Semoun, Giuseppe Querques, Eric H. Souied, Salomon Y. Cohen, Mayer Srour, Hassiba Oubraham, Vittorio Capuano, Rocío Blanco-Garavito and Carl P. Herbort and has published in prestigious journals such as Investigative Ophthalmology & Visual Science, British Journal of Ophthalmology and Retina.
